How to delete orphaned virtual volume files on the equallogic

$
0
0

This is in reference to the following VMware kb article:

https://kb.vmware.com/selfservice/microsites/search.do?language=en_US&cmd=displayKC&externalId=2108332

So what commands or gui options are available to delete orphaned virtual volume objects?

vSphere shows the virtual volume as empty but a used space of 53GB out of 1TB. The equallogic gui shows multiple VMs with 0 Mb in size associated with the storage container. Attempts to delete from gui and ssh results in the following error "Storage Container must be empty to be deleted". The storage container is also showing that it has snapshot and linked clones that I cannot access.
